Westfield Fire Causes $25,000 Loss in Incendiary Blaze

A morning fire at John McCraden's two story barn in Westfield, April Mire noted as incendiary, destroyed the barn and gear. Loss exceeded $25,000, including a team of horses, cows, calves, tractors, a roadster, chickens, fertilizer, hay, oats, tools, and farming machinery. Funeral of Thos Costello

Requiem mass was celebrated at St Thomas Church this morning for the late Thomas Costello. The service began at 9:30, with many relatives and friends in attendance. pallbearers included John Dugan, John Cournes, John Costello, Clyde Wynn, Edward Kinley, and Arthur Carlson. Relatives from out of town joined the service, including John Costello of Niagara Falls, N.Y., Tessie and Margaret McInerny of Brooklyn, and Miss Lucy McMahon of Gin Pa.
